Notice of Application and Public Hearing

Notice of Application and Public Hearing

The Moses Lake Irrigation and Rehabilitation District submitted an application for a Substantial Shoreline Development Permit, Shoreline Conditional Use Permit, and C-R Zone Conditional Use Permit on November 23, 2015. Additional information was submitted on January 23 and February 19, 2016. The application was determined to be substantially complete and ready for review on February 26, 2016. The proposed project location is Parker Horn in Moses Lake, mostly upstream of Neppel Crossing (Stratford Road). The proposal is to continue the hydraulic dredging of Parker Horn. In total, up to 300,000 cubic yards of sediment will be removed with a hydraulic dredge and pumped to upland dewatering basins. After dewatering, the sediment will be moved to stockpiles for further drying before being hauled offsite. The project has been determined to be consistent with the City's Comprehensive Plan and the following Development Regulations are applicable to the project: City of Moses Lake Municipal Code Title 14 Environmental Regulations, Title 18 Zoning, Title 19.06 Wetlands, and Title 20 Development Review Process; City of Moses Lake Shorelines Management Master Plan.
